The Three Peaks Camping Road Trip
Rather than just revelling in the journey on your 2018 camping road trip, why not set yourself a challenge? One famous example would be to summit the three national highest peaks in the UK – Mount Snowdon in Wales, Skafell Pike in England and Ben Nevis in Scotland. Conquering these three mountains should not be taken lightly, but could give you a focus to your tour, as well as a massive sense of accomplishment.

Coastal Journey
Sticking close to one coastline for your whole road trip is also a good way to see some of the UK's most beautiful vistas and many interesting natural attractions. The Jurassic Coast drive on the south coast, for example, will take you through some lovely landscape, with stunning sea views, with plenty of man made attractions in the vicinity to keep everyone entertained. Alternatively, how about a road trip down the stunning coast of Northumberland or Yorkshire? Or along the coast of Pembrokeshire in Wales? There are plenty of options.
